The first Virtual Console hack eliminating the DRM, a feature that protects it from copying, has recently been released to select private groups, with a public release allegedly soon to follow. The game, which we wont name here, can be installed by using the hack within Twilight Princess or a modified burnt disk (and modchip_. While this is a step forward for the development of custom channels and other homebrew, the piracy implications will no doubt cause Nintendo to step in and put a lock on this issue as soon as possible.
